Product Specifications
- Peptide Name: Tesamorelin
- Molecular Formula: C221H366N72O67S
- Molecular Weight: 5135.89 g/mol
- CAS Number: 218949-48-5
- Sequence: Trans-3-hexenoyl-Tyr-Ala-Asp-Ala-Ile-Phe-Thr-Asn-Ser-Tyr-Arg-Lys-Val-Leu-Gly-Gln-Leu-Ser-Ala-Arg-Lys-Leu-Leu-Gln-Asp-Ile-Met-Ser-Arg-Gln-Gln-Gly-Glu-Ser-Asn-Gln-Glu-Arg-Gly-Ala-Arg-Ala-Arg-Leu-NH2
- Purity: ≥99% (HPLC)
- Form: Lyophilized peptide powder
- Storage: -20°C (long-term) | 2–8°C (short-term) | Protect from light
- Shelf Life: Up to 12 months when stored sealed and dry
Compound Overview
Tesamorelin is a synthetic peptide corresponding to the full 44-amino-acid sequence of growth hormone-releasing hormone with an N-terminal trans-3-hexenoyl modification and a C-terminal amide. Structurally, it is classified as a stabilized GHRH analog and is defined by a linear peptide backbone with a terminal modification that influences physicochemical and analytical properties in laboratory workflows.
In laboratory research contexts, Tesamorelin is evaluated for receptor-binding characterization, peptide stability profiling, and analytical detection using chromatographic and mass spectrometry workflows. Experimental literature describes its use in comparative studies involving structurally related GHRH-class peptides under controlled in vitro and preclinical animal model conditions. Compare to Related Compounds
CJC-1295 No DAC
- Tesamorelin is a stabilized GHRH (1–44) analog with an N-terminal modification, whereas CJC-1295 No DAC is a modified GHRH analog with distinct sequence alterations and structural classification.
- Comparative analytical panels differentiate these compounds based on molecular weight, sequence composition, and chromatographic behavior in peptide profiling workflows.
Ipamorelin
- Tesamorelin is classified as a GHRH receptor–targeting peptide analog, whereas Ipamorelin is a distinct peptide class evaluated in growth hormone secretagogue receptor research systems.
- These compounds differ in primary sequence framework, receptor classification, and analytical identification signatures under validated laboratory conditions.
Handling & Storage
Lyophilized Stability:
When stored sealed in a dry environment protected from light, lyophilized peptide material may maintain chemical stability for up to 12 months at controlled room temperature. For maximum long-term preservation, storage at -20°C is recommended.
Post-Reconstitution Stability:
Following reconstitution under sterile laboratory conditions, the solution may maintain stability for up to 30 days when stored at 2–8°C. Minimize repeated freeze–thaw cycles and protect from light to preserve peptide integrity.
Handling:
Allow vial to equilibrate to room temperature before opening to prevent moisture condensation. Use sterile technique throughout preparation.
